Organize your team, club or group. Save time. Focus on what matters. The free app trusted by millions of coaches, club admins, parents and players worldwide. Spond is the app that makes sports happen. Whether you're running a sports club or organizing activities with your friends, Spond keeps everyone in sync. Stop chasing RSVPs, outdated contact info or late payments. What you can do: • Schedule training, matches and events • Set up recurring events for the whole season at once • Sync everything with your personal calendar • See who's coming with automatic RSVP tracking • Collect membership fees and event payments securely • Send reminders and keep track of who has paid • Manage multiple teams with sub-groups and set member roles • Import members from Excel or add via link, email or SMS • Export attendance lists and data to Excel • Set up your starting line-ups for matches • Keep track of match goals and vote player of the match • Communicate via group chats, posts and polls • Store photos and documents in custom folders and file structures • Manage children's accounts safely as a guardian with full visibility of communication with coaches Built for coaches, club admins, parents and players. Spond saves a coach an average of 2 hours per week on admin tasks. That's more time on the field, less time in spreadsheets and group message chats. Works for all sports and activities.
